OBJECTIVE@#To investigate the clinical effect of unilateral percutaneous vertebroplasty (PVP) combined with 3D printing technology for the treatment of thoracolumbar osteoporotic compression fracture.@*METHODS@#A total of 77 patients with thoracolumbar osteoporotic compression fractures from October 2020 to April 2022 were included in the study, all of which were vertebral body compression fractures caused by trauma. According to different treatment methods, they were divided into experimental group and control group. Thirty-two patients used 3D printing technology to improve unilateral transpedicle puncture vertebroplasty in the experimental group, there were 5 males and 27 females, aged from 63 to 91 years old with an average of (77.59±8.75) years old. Forty-five patients were treated with traditional bilateral pedicle puncture vertebroplasty, including 7 males and 38 females, aged from 60 to 88 years old with an average of(74.89±7.37) years old. Operation time, intraoperative C-arm X-ray times, anesthetic dosage, bone cement injection amount, bone cement diffusion good and good rate, complications, vertebral height, kyphotic angle (Cobb angle), visual analogue scale(VAS), Oswestry disability index (ODI) and other indicators were recorded before and after surgery, and statistically analyzed.@*RESULTS@#All patients were followed up for 6 to 23 months, with preoperative imaging studies, confirmed for thoracolumbar osteoporosis compression fractures, two groups of patients with postoperative complications, no special two groups of patients' age, gender, body mass index (BMI), time were injured, the injured vertebral distribution had no statistical difference(P>0.05), comparable data. Two groups of patients with bone cement injection, bone cement dispersion rate, preoperative and postoperative vertebral body height, protruding after spine angle(Cobb angle), VAS, ODI had no statistical difference(P>0.05). The operative time, intraoperative fluoroscopy times and anesthetic dosage were statistically different between the two groups(P<0.05). Compared with the traditional bilateral puncture group, the modified unilateral puncture group combined with 3D printing technology had shorter operation time, fewer intraoperative fluoroscopy times and less anesthetic dosage. The height of anterior vertebral edge, kyphosis angle (Cobb angle), VAS score and ODI of the affected vertebrae were statistically different between two groups at each time point after surgery(P<0.05).@*CONCLUSION@#In the treatment of thoracolumbar osteoporotic compression fractures, 3D printing technology is used to improve unilateral puncture PVP, which is convenient and simple, less trauma, short operation time, fewer fluoroscopy times, satisfactory distribution of bone cement, vertebral height recovery and kyphotic Angle correction, and good functional improvement.

OBJECTIVE@#To evaluate accuracy and safety of individualized 3D printing guided template for thoracolumbar pedicle screw placement in patients with ankylosing spondylitis.@*METHODS@#From January 2016 to September 2019, thoracolumbar spine three-dimensional CT data of 8 patients with ankylosing spondylitis were included, Mimics 17.0 and ideaMaker computer software were applied to design thoracolumbar pedicle screw guided template of patients with AS, physical model of all patients (T-L)were printed by 3D printer, 2 parts in each patient, and divided into guide-plate-assisted screw group (experimental group) and free-hand nail group (control group). Thoracolumbar pedicle screws of both groups were placed by the same spinal surgeon. The accuracy of pedicle screw placement between two groups were evaluated according to results of postoperative CT, the accuracy of the fixation of thoracolumbar pedicle screw was divided into 4 grades, grade 0 and 1 screws were acceptable nails, grade 2 and 3 screws were unacceptable nails. The diameter and length of pedicle screws, the distance between entry point and posterior median line designed by preoperative 3D printing were compared with actual use in operation.@*RESULTS@#Twenty three blocks of thoracolumbar 3D printing screw of ankylosing spondylitis guided templates were designed and printed in guide-plate-assisted screw group, 46 screws were inserted and 44 screws were accepted. The time of implanting a screw into thoracolumbar pedicle was (4.20±1.15) min, the frequency of X-ray was (5.00±1.25) times and the average adjustment times of screw and Kirschner needle during screw placement was (1.76±1.32) times. In the control group, 46 nails were placed by traditional surgical method and 30 screws were accepted. The time of implanting a screw into thoracolumbar pedicle was (14.67±2.23) min, the frequency of X-ray fluoroscopy was (14.46±2.21) times and the average times of Kirschner needle adjustment was (4.76±3.39) times. The success rates between experimental group and control group were 95.65%(44 / 46) and 56.22%(30 / 46) respectively, and had statistical difference (χ=13.538, 0.05). The operation time of inserting a single screw, the times of X-ray fluoroscopy, and the average times of adjustment screw and Kirschner needle in experimental group were significant less than those in control group(<0.01).@*CONCLUSION@#The personalized guide template assisted the thoracolumbar fixation designed by 3D printing could significantly improve safety, accuracy and efficiency of surgery, especially suitable for thoracolumbar vertebral bodies requiring posterior pedicle screw fixation for fracture or dislocation with AS.

To investigate the effects of aerobic exercise and resveratrol on janus kinase 2(JAK2) and transforming growth factor-β1(TGF-β1) in renal tissue of type 2 diabetes rats and its mechanism. Methods: The model of type 2 diabetic rats was established through SD rats fed high-fat diet for 5 weeks together with intraperitoneal infecting after a low dose of STZ. The rats were randomly divided into diabetic control group(DC), diabetic exercise group(DE), diabetic resveratrol group(DR), diabetic exercise and resveratrol group(DER), normal control group(NC), 12 rats in each group. Exercise-related groups performed 8 weeks treadmill exercise (20 m/min, 60 min/day). Resveratrol was administered to drug-related groups for 8 weeks (45 mg/kg, 7 day/week). Eight weeks later, we examined blood glucose concentrations, 24 h microalbuminuria(UA), serum creatinine(Scr), blood urea nitrogen(BUN), and the expressions of TGF-β1, janus kinase 2(JAK2) and JAK2 mRNA in renal tissue. After eight weeks of intervention, compared with NC group, the concentrations blood glucose, 24 h UA, Scr, BUN, the expressions of TGF-β1, JAK2 and JAK2 mRNA were increased significantly in DC group(P<0.05). Compared with DC group, the concentrations of blood glucose, 24 h UA, Scr, BUN, the expressions of TGF-β1, JAK2 and JAK2 mRNA were decreased significantly in DE group, DR group and DER group(P<0.05). Exercise, resveratrol and combined intervention may decrease the expressions of JAK2 mRNA, JAK2 and TGF-β1, which further attenuate renal injury for type 2 diabetes. The renal protective effect produced by exercise and resveratrol combined intervention is better than that produced by exercise or resveratrol intervention alone.

OBJECTIVE@#To explore the application value of 3D printing technology in preoperative surgery plan and intraoperative auxiliary operation for adult kyphoscoliosis deformity.@*METHODS@#The clinical data of 12 adult patients with kyphoscoliosis deformity treated from September 2017 to January 2019 were retrospectively analyzed. There were 3 males and 9 females, aged from 21 to 63 years old with an average of (47.67±13.32) years old. Among them, 4 cases were congenital kyphoscoliosis, 2 cases were old tuberculosis thoracolumbar kyphosis ; 2 cases were idiopathic kyphoscoliosis, 4 cases were degenerative kyphoscoliosis. The CT scan data of the patient's spine was imported into Mimics17.0 software to establish the three dimensional model of the spine, and the spine model was produced by 3D printer. Using the spine model simulated operation, preoperative surgery program planning and formulated a precise surgery, and further analysed postoperative imaging parameters improvement. All the patients were followed up for more than 1 year. Before and after operation and at the last follow-up, the scoliosis Cobb angle, maximum kyphosis Cobb angle, and coronal plane balance (distance between C 7 plumbline and center sacral vertical line, CPL-CSVL), sagittal plane balance (sagittal vertical axis, SVA), pelvic parameters and other related imaging parameters were measured to further evaluate its orthopedic effect.@*RESULTS@#Twelve patients with spine deformity were treated with different osteotomy and internal fixation fusion methods under the guidance of a 1∶1 spine model (pedicle screw placement of 4 patients with severe deformity were assisted by pedicle screw guide plates), nail placement and osteotomy have good effects, no major tissue damage such as blood vessels, nerves and spinal cord during and after surgery, no complications such as cerebrospinal fluid leakage and infection. Preoperative Cobb angle of scoliosis was (56.5±22.5) °, Cobb angle of kyphosis was (65.2±19.5) °, C PL-CSVL was (45.8±16.9) mm, SVA was (48.7±25.4) mm. Postoperative at 4 weeks, Cobb angle of scoliosis was (20.8±11.5) °, and Cobb angle of kyphosis was (22.0±6.6) °, with correction rates of (65.1±9.7)% and (64.6± 10.6)%, respectively ; C PL-CSVL was (22.3±8.9) mm, and SVA was (23.3±13.1) mm, all of which were significantly improved compared with preoperative results. The mean follow-up time was (18.5±7.9) months in 12 patients. At the last follow-up, the Cobb angles of scoliosis and kyphosis were (22.2±10.8) ° and (23.6±7.7) °, respectively, C PL-CSVL was (23.5±10.8) mm, and SVA was (24.7±12.5) mm. The results were statistically significant compared preoperative (0.05).@*CONCLUSION@#The 3D print model can visually and clearly show the vertebral morphology and structure of adult kyphoscolisis and its spatial relationship with the adjacent vertebrae, blood vessels, and nerves, which provides a good and intuitive stereoscopic anatomical structure observation for the individualization of the surgical plan. Pre-simulation of operations to determine the internal fixation, fusion segment and osteotomy orthopedic way, may to provide a reference for actual clinical surgery, and can improve the accuracy and safety of surgery.

Objective To describe the serum levels of Th1/Th2 cytokines of tuberculosis (TB) patients from East China before anti-TB treatment and the impact factors in order to provide information for TB diagnosis and treatment.Methods Four fields of TB appointed hospitals from two provinces in East China were selected.All newly diagnosed and registered active TB patients from Apr.,2013 to Mar.,2014 were investigated by self-designed questionnaire.ELISA was used to test the levels of IFN-γ and IL-10 in the serum.Results Totally 1 289 active TB patients were enrolled in the study sites,of whom 83.1 % and 75.5 % were reported having cough and sputum,respectively.The levels of IFN-γ and IL-10 were (2.086 ± 1.119) pg/mL and (2.576 ± 1.192) pg/mL,respectively.The ratio of Th1/Th2 was 0.81 (CIFN-γ/CIL-10,C stands for concentration).The level of IFN-γ was lower in patients with cough and sputum,while it was higher in those with fever,fatigue and night sweats (P<0.05).In addition,the level of IFN-γ in initial treatment patients was higher than that in retreatment cases (P<0.05).It was found that drinking tea could raise the level of IFN-γ (P<0.05),drinking wine and taking a regular balanced diet could reduce the level of IL-10 (P<0.05).Conclusions The symptoms of TB patients deserved attention.A healthy eating habits can help to achieve a high level of immunity and to correct the imbalance of Th1/Th2 cytokines in the course of disease.

Objective To investigate the contribution of recent transmission in the epidemic of drug-resistant Mycobacterium tuberculosis (M. TB) and related factors from biomedical and social-demographic perspectives in the Eastern rural areas of China. Methods Identified by proportio5n method of drug susceptibility test, 223 drug resistant M. TB isolates and their hosts were included in the present study. These drug resistant tuberculosis isolates were first genotyped by Mycobacterial Interspersed Repetitive Units(MIRU),and those isolates with identical MIRU defined as two patients' M. TB isolates harboring the identical MIRU genotype and IS6110-based RFLP pattern simultaneously. Unique strains denoted those with the unparalleled MIRU genotype in the study collection. Socio-demographic and biomedical characteristics of host patients were compared between the clusters and unique groups through univariate and multivariate logistic regression analysis. Results Based on the MIRU-IS6110 pattern, there were 52 isolates belonged to the "cluster" group and 171 as the "unique" group. Drug resistant M. TB strain isolated from patients at the age of 30-60 year had a higher probability of being clustered, comparing to those from patients below 30 years of age (30.9% vs. 11.9%;OR=3.297; 95%CI: 1.169-9.297). Such finding were also seen in the isolates from patients with previous treatment history compared to newly diagnosed patients (32.9% vs. 18.4%; OR=2.163, 95% CI: 1.144-4.090). The multi-drug resistant M. TB strain was found to have been more frequently clustered when comparing to the mono-drug resistant M. TB (47.2% vs. 15.5%; OR=4.773; 95%CI: 2.316-9.837). The transmission pattern of drug resistant tuberculosis was presented mainly by the sporadic distribution in small group within rural villages. Conclusion Transmission of drug-resistant tuberculosis was seen in the population living in the Eastern rural areas of China, and causal contact within villages was considered as the main route of recent transmission. Patients at middle age and having previous tuberculosis treatment history might have increased the risk of transmission by patients with drug resistant tuberculosis.

Objective To describe the drug resistance-related molecular characterization and clustering feature of rifampicin-resistant (RIFr) M.tuberculosis (M.tb) in rural area of eastern China. Methods All patients diagnosed as RIFr M.tb in Deqing and Guanyun county during one year period from 2004 to 2005 were included in the study. By proportion method of drug susceptibility test, 65 isolates were identified resistant to rifampicin and regarded as the studied strains. Hotspots of rpoB gene and katG gene were detected by direct DNA sequencing. Beijing genotype M.tb strains were identified by spoligotyping. IS6110-RFLP (IS6110 restriction fragment length polymorphism) and clustering analysis were performed on all RIFr M.tb isolates available. Results The mutations in 81 bp rifampicin-resistance determination region (RRDR) of the rpoB gene were observed among 60 (92%) RIFr M.tb isolates, with mutation in locus 531 observed in the majority of RIFr isolates (37/65). 49(82%) of the 60 isolates were multidrug resistant TB (MDR-TB), which were referred to as resistant to both RIF and isoniazid (INH). Through spoligotyping, 54(83%) isolates were identified as Beijing genotype strains. In clustering analysis of IS6110-RFLP, 24 isolates were grouped into 11 clusters, suggesting that the recent transmission of M.tb did exist among patients. Regarding the drug resistance profile in clusters, all the isolates in clusters were also MDR-TB. 7 clusters contained isolates carrying different mutations were related to RIF-resistance. Multivariate analysis showed the proportion of new cases in clustered patients is higher than that in the un-clustered patients (new/previously treated: OR=3.342; 95% CI: 1.081-10.32). Conclusion The acquisition of rifampicin resistance in M.tb was more likely to be resulted from the selective growth of RIFr M.tb in the specific drug resistant M.tb such as isoniazid-reisistant M.tb. Previous elongated irregular treatment might favor the epidemic of RIFr M.tb.

Objective To investigate the therapeutic efficacy of short course chemotherapy (SCC)on drug resistant tuberculosis (DR-TB) cases and related influencing socioeconomic factors. TB patients registered in local county TB dispensaries of two rural counties were followed up in Deqing and Guanyun of Eastern China, during 2004/2005. Methods Culture-positive patients (Deqing: 182, Guanyun: 217)were selected as subjects of this study. A cohort of TB patients was established at the beginning of their treatment and each patient was followed-up three times by questionnaires. Proportional method of drug susceptibility test was used to define the resistance to the 1st-line anti-TB drugs.χ2 test Kaplan-Meier method and Cox analysis were applied in multivariate analysis to investigate the negative conversion of smear positive sputum, treatment result of SCC and its socioeconomic influencing factors. Results The cure rates of multi-drug resistant TB (MDR-TB),other drug resistant TB (ODR-TB) and pan-drug susceptible TB,were 58.3%, 91.0%, 98.7% and 51.3%, 89.5%, 93.5% respectively in Deqing and Guanyun. The liver dysfunction (RR = 0.18, 95% CI:0. 04-0. 69 ) and previous treatment history (RR = 0.26,95% CI:0.07-0.93) were associated with treatment result among MDR-TB. Result on treatment in ODR-TB was influenced by previous treatment history (RR = 0.66, 95% CI:0. 44-0. 98 ) and Patient delay (>2 weeks)(RR = 0.67, 95% CI: 0.46-0.97). Conclusion The priority in treating MDR-TB would include:managing side effect, developing the fast sensitive drug susceptibility test and modifying the treatment regimen corresponding to drug resistance.

<p><b>OBJECTIVE</b>To evaluate the serious response during tilt-table test (TTT) and its prophylactic management.</p><p><b>METHOD</b>Seventy-six elderly patients were tested at a tilt angle of 70 degrees for a maximum of 45 min and then subjected to isoproterenol-provocative tilt testing. ECG and blood pressure were monitored during the test and patients were kept at normal saline condition through a peripheral intravenous duct.</p><p><b>RESULTS</b>Fifty-one of 76 patients were defined as positive including 23 having serious response; 6 of the 23 patients had arteriosclerosis involving internal carotid arteries and 7 cases had bradycardia, two of which were associated with II degrees -I A-V block and the others with chronic atrial fibrillation. The serious response consisted of cardiac arrest for more than 5 s (6 cases), or serious bradycardia for more than 1 min (7 cases) or serious hypotension for more than 1 min (10 cases). Those with serious response were managed by returning to supine position, thus driving up legs and intravenous atropine, CPR (2 cases with cardiac arrest) and needing oxygen supplementation (11 cases). Only 2 hypotension patients recovered gradually by 10 min after emergency management, while others recovered rapidly with no complications.</p><p><b>CONCLUSION</b>Although non-invasive, TTT may result in serious response, especially in elderly. Therefore proper patient selection, control of isoproterenol infusion and close observation of vital signs are decisive for a safe consequence.</p>

<p><b>OBJECTIVE</b>To understand the determinants and epidemiology of drug-resistant tuberculosis (TB) in rural area.</p><p><b>METHODS</b>All the diagnosed TB patients in a county with directly observed treatment (DOTS) short-course program in 2002 and a sample of patients in another county without DOTS program located in northern Jiangsu province were surveyed with questionnaires. Drug susceptibility testing (DST) for positive cultures were performed by standardized proportion method. Univariable analysis and multivariate nonconditional logistic regression modeling were applied for data analysis.</p><p><b>RESULTS</b>Among the 152 patients with DST results, 32.9% of the cases showed resistance to at least one of the first-line anti-tuberculosis drugs with 26.3% to isoniazid, 18.4% to rifampin and 17.1% to both isoniazid and rifampin respectively. Previous treatments for TB and residence in the county without DOTS program were independent risk factors for isoniazid and rifampin resistance. TB patients showing indifferent to their health and delayed health seeking for more than 1 month were more likely to have rifampin resistance. Independent predictors of multidrug-resistant TB would include delayed health seeking for more than 1 month (OR = 4.66, 95% CI: 1.26 - 17.24), residing in the county without a DOTS program (OR = 3.01, 95% CI: 1.10 - 8.22), indifference to their health condition (OR = 5.13, 95% CI: 1.06 - 24.90) and suffering from chronic diseases (OR = 0.22, 95% CI: 0.05 - 0.87).</p><p><b>CONCLUSION</b>Drug-resistant TB was quite serious in this rural areas, mainly associated with man-made factors but partly due to the availability of the transmission.</p>
